Oracle软件带来的CDBC技术的巨大改变(oracle_cdbc)

随着互联网和大数据时代的到来,数据库技术也在不断地发展和创新。Oracle作为全球顶级的数据库软件供应商,一直以来都在持续不断的创新和研发,为用户提供更加智能、高效的解决方案。其中,CDBC(Common DataBase Connectivity)技术就是近年来Oracle软件所带来的巨大改变。

CDBC技术是一种通用的数据库访问接口,可以对各种数据库进行统一的访问。CDBC技术已经广泛应用于各种企业级应用程序中,如ERP、CRM、OA等等。与传统的数据库访问方式相比,CDBC技术具有以下几个优势:

1. 高效性:CDBC技术使用了高效的数据库访问方式,极大地提高了数据的访问和查询效率。

2. 可扩展性:由于CDBC技术的通用性,可以对各种数据库进行访问,因此具有很高的可扩展性。

3. 易用性:CDBC技术的接口设计非常简单,使用起来非常方便,几乎没有学习成本。

如何在Oracle软件中实现CDBC技术呢?下面就简单介绍一下:

1. 安装Oracle驱动程序:在Oracle官网上下载对应的Oracle驱动程序并安装。

2. 配置ODBC数据源:在控制面板中找到ODBC数据源,添加Oracle数据源,并填写好相应的参数。

3. 编写代码:在应用程序中,调用相应的函数来访问数据库即可,Oracle提供了很多现成的API函数,例如下面这个例子:

“`java

import java.sql.Connection;

import java.sql.DriverManager;

import java.sql.PreparedStatement;

import java.sql.ResultSet;

import java.sql.SQLException;

public class OracleDemo {

public static void mn(String[] args) throws ClassNotFoundException, SQLException {

Class.forName(“oracle.jdbc.driver.OracleDriver”);

Connection conn = DriverManager.getConnection(“jdbc:oracle:thin:@localhost:1521:orcl”, “username”, “password”);

String sql = “select * from table where id=?”;

PreparedStatement pstmt = conn.prepareStatement(sql);

pstmt.setInt(1, 1);

ResultSet rs = pstmt.executeQuery();

while(rs.next()) {

System.out.println(rs.getString(“name”));

System.out.println(rs.getInt(“age”));

}

rs.close();

pstmt.close();

conn.close();

}

}


在这个例子中,我们通过JDBC连接Oracle数据库,然后执行一条查询语句,最后将查询结果输出。

Oracle软件带来的CDBC技术的巨大改变在企业级应用程序中得到了广泛应用。通过CDBC技术,我们可以更加方便快捷地访问不同类型的数据库,提高我们的工作效率。同时,Oracle也在不断地创新和完善CDBC技术,为用户提供更加智能、高效的数据库解决方案。

数据运维技术 » Oracle软件带来的CDBC技术的巨大改变(oracle_cdbc)